Keep trying, you never know. Pay more attention to people SEEING a cat like her in the area and go look for yourself. She would be very unlikely to go to someone. Make sure you keep in touch with the local shelter. Facebook is a good outlet to post a picture of her on, it reaches a lot more people and young people are more likely to be in more places and spot her. Make sure to point out the area where she got out. Most radio stations have lost and found, or even the for sale spots that you could get onto for free and make your plea, that would reach older people who might be feeding her.
